Responsibilities

  • Lead day-to-day production support, incident command, escalation, stakeholder communication, postmortems, and corrective actions.
  • Own on-call rotation design, escalation paths, alert tuning, PagerDuty and New Relic tooling, and high-severity incident response.
  • Define and maintain SLIs and SLOs, observability, monitoring, alerting, runbooks, diagnostics, and automation to reduce MTTD and MTTR.
  • Lead Terraform-based infrastructure automation and eliminate repetitive operational toil.
  • Add automated rollback, change-risk checks, and progressive-delivery reliability guardrails to CI/CD pipelines.
  • Maintain supported, secure, and current cloud services, Kubernetes clusters, operating systems, runtimes, and infrastructure components.
  • Own backup, recovery, failover, recovery testing, runbooks, and RTO/RPO readiness for production platforms.
  • Maintain operational controls and audit evidence for access management, change management, logging, vulnerability remediation, patch management, security, and compliance.
  • Mentor and technically lead SRE, DevOps, consulting-partner, junior, and contract engineers through pairing, reviews, and incident debriefs.
  • Partner with software engineering, QA, architecture, Security, Quality, Compliance, and business stakeholders on reliability, resilience, regulatory compliance, and disaster recovery.
  • Support capacity planning, resilience testing, cloud cost optimization, and AI-enabled internal tooling and system integrations.

Requirements

  • Demonstrated experience leading production support and incident management, including incident command during high-severity events.
  • Strong grounding in SRE principles including SLIs, SLOs, blameless postmortems, toil reduction, and reliability engineering.
  • Experience owning on-call strategy, rotation design, alert tuning, and escalation.
  • Expertise with Terraform or comparable infrastructure as code at scale, including module design, state management, and policy-as-code guardrails.
  • Hands-on experience building reliable CI/CD pipelines with GitHub Actions, Octopus Deploy, or Azure DevOps.
  • Deep experience with AWS, Azure, or GCP and with Docker and Kubernetes.
  • Working knowledge of Prometheus, Grafana, Datadog, CloudWatch, ELK, or OpenSearch for SLO-based alerting.
  • Experience designing and testing disaster recovery, including backup and restore, failover, and RTO/RPO validation.
  • Working knowledge of cloud security, IAM, network segmentation, encryption, vulnerability management, patch management, and cloud cost optimization.
  • Proficiency in Python, Go, or Bash for automation and tooling.
  • 10+ years in Site Reliability Engineering, DevOps, or infrastructure engineering, including production support, infrastructure as code, CI/CD, disaster recovery, and security/compliance partnership.
  • At least 2 years mentoring or technically leading remote, offshore, or contracted engineers.
  • Bachelor of Science in Computer Science or equivalent education and applicable experience; technical school training and relevant certifications may also qualify, with production experience weighted more heavily than the degree.
  • Relevant AWS, Azure, or GCP Professional- or Architect-level certifications are preferred.
  • Experience in FDA- and ISO-regulated industries and with agile methodologies is preferred.

About Tandem Diabetes Care

1,001-5,000 employees

Tandem Diabetes Care designs and sells insulin delivery systems for people with diabetes, including the t:slim X2 and Tandem Mobi pumps with Control-IQ automated insulin delivery, plus the t:connect data app and infusion sets. The public company (NASDAQ) generates revenue from device sales and ongoing pump supplies. Founded in 2006 and headquartered in San Diego, it serves U.S. and international markets through healthcare providers and direct distribution.
